Agricultural algaecides are chemical substances used to eradicate and inhibit the growth of algae and cyanobacteria. These substances are employed to mitigate or reduce extensive algal blooms and eliminate phytoplankton. One widely used algaecide is copper sulfate, which is highly soluble in water. When dissolved in water and applied through injection or spraying, copper sulfate induces immediate senescence in algae.

The primary types of agricultural algaecides available on the market include copper sulfate, chelated copper, peroxyacetic acid, hydrogen peroxide, dyes and colorants, and others. Copper sulfate finds applications in both agricultural and non-agricultural settings, serving various purposes such as fungicides, algaecides, root killers, and herbicides. This chemical compound, denoted as CuSO4 and known by names like blue vitriol, the vitriol of copper, and bluestone, operates through different modes of action, including selective and non-selective. The categories of algaecides encompass both synthetic and natural options, available in solid and liquid forms.

The agricultural algaecides market size has grown strongly in recent years. It will grow from $3.61 billion in 2024 to $3.86 billion in 2025 at a compound annual growth rate (CAGR) of 6.8%. The growth in the historic period can be attributed to growing concerns about water quality, expansion of aquaculture industry, traditional agricultural practices, crop protection.

The agricultural algaecides market size is expected to see strong growth in the next few years. It will grow to $5.29 billion in 2029 at a compound annual growth rate (CAGR) of 8.2%. The growth in the forecast period can be attributed to global population growth, climate change impact, rising awareness of sustainable agriculture, emerging markets. Major trends in the forecast period include increasing emphasis on bio-based algaecides, precision agriculture adoption, collaborations and partnerships, focus on research and development, digital farming solutions, global market expansion.

Anticipated expansion in the aquaculture industry is set to drive the growth of the agricultural algaecide market. The aquaculture sector, synonymous with aquafarming or fish farming, involves the controlled cultivation, breeding, and harvesting of aquatic organisms like fish, shellfish, and aquatic plants. Algaecides play a crucial role in managing and controlling algae growth in aquaculture systems, ensuring the health and productivity of fish and shellfish and, consequently, fueling the demand for effective algaecides. A report by the U. S. Department of Agriculture (USDA) in February 2022 projected the total fish production to reach approximately 2. 2 million metric tons (MMT) in 2021, with aquaculture contributing 1. 7 MMT. Egypt, aiming to achieve 3 MMT in fish production by 2025, anticipates a surge in fish feed demand, estimated at around 650,000 metric tons. Hence, the expansion of the aquaculture industry is propelling the growth of the agricultural algaecides market.

Key players in the agricultural algaecide market are actively developing innovative products, such as non-copper-based algaecides, to cater to broader customer bases, drive increased sales, and boost overall revenue. Non-copper-based algaecides are chemical formulations designed to control or eliminate algae growth in diverse environments, including water bodies, without containing copper-based active ingredients. Lake Restoration, a U. S. -based aquatic plant management company, exemplified this trend by introducing Cape Furl in May 2022, an algaecide and fungicide suitable for application in aquatic environments with live fish and plants. Notably, Cape Furl distinguishes itself as a user-friendly, copper-free algaecide, offering a swift and effective solution for eradicating algae, mold, or moss. Approved by the Environmental Protection Agency (EPA), Cape Furl contains sodium carbonate peroxyhydrate (SCP) and provides a safe and efficient remedy for eliminating algae in ponds, ensuring the well-being of sensitive fish species like trout, koi, and channel catfish that may be negatively impacted by copper-based algaecides. Application methods include broadcasting the granular powder directly over algae-affected areas or dissolving the granules in water and subsequently spraying them onto algae mats.

In July 2023, De Sangosse, a France-based company specializing in crop protection, plant nutrition, and pest control products, acquired AlgaEnergy for an undisclosed amount. This acquisition aims to strengthen De Sangosse's position in the agricultural biosolutions market by utilizing AlgaEnergy's expertise in micro-algae technologies to enhance sustainable farming practices and accelerate global growth in biostimulants, biofertilizers, and biocontrol products. AlgaEnergy is a Spain-based microalgae biotechnology company that includes algaecides among its product offerings.
